Output 881366fc510fbbd5dfa394e8b51d5326825d94d3641550018e7f318f8f347cbd:1

value
19639853
script pubkey
OP_0 OP_PUSHBYTES_20 5dcc6a2dcee04801cdc390190181eb8bbc75ea95
address
bc1qthxx5twwupyqrnwrjqvsrq0t3w78t654626vtn
transaction
881366fc510fbbd5dfa394e8b51d5326825d94d3641550018e7f318f8f347cbd
spent
true